CHAPTER 4 : FOOTBALL IS PLAYED AND MISTAKES ARE MADE


1. Newt stops thinking about Halloween when he recalls the moment Chris
mentions Reggie Ratner, an opponent from Merrimac High, who has always been
holding grudges against his brother.
2. To make it worst, during the Big Game, the crowd play sentiment on both Chris
and Reggie.
3. Newt, who is now away from his bleacher, is shown his way out after he fails to
present his seat ticket to the person in charge.
4. When the final quarter starts, both teams are level and unfortunately, Newt is
forced to watch the game from outside the wire fence surrounding Fillmore Field.
5. He can see that the Home team, especially his brother, is playing their hearts out
until the game reaches its last 45 seconds – the Away team is leading by two
points.
6. Without giving up, the Big Game is getting more intense during the last seven
seconds.
7. The Ferrets show high determination and Chris manages to get a last minute
touchdown.
8. There are mixed feelings on the ground as the opponents bow down to their
defeat and the home crowd is jubilant with the winning streak.

CHAPTER 5 : THE BAD DREAMS BEGIN


1. Chris is unconscious as the result of the winning touchdown.
2. The whole ground is in complete silence when Chris is being attended and
brought to the hospital.
3. Chris’ test results come out and fortunately he is not suffering from any broken
parts, he is just in coma.
4. Back in his room, Newt still cannot forget what happened during the winning
touchdown as he describes it as the thunderous crash.
5. He tries to revert his concentration to Halloween as the Big Game incident keeps
rewinding in his mind.
6. The next day, Newt answers various callers trying to get some news about Chris.
7. Cecil and JJ drop by at Newt’s house to give a few things to cheer him up.
8. The local community is talking about the touchdown incident and starts calling
it the Big Tackle.
